The following information was sent to families via SchoolMessenger on Friday, May 17 with the subject "Safe2Tell Update". The content has been formatted for the web.


May 17, 2024

Dear West Jefferson Middle School Staff and Families,

Last night we received another Safe2Tell report sharing a safety concern that a student overhead another on a bus say something about making a bomb with Vaseline and bleach.

The Jeffco Public Schools Department of School Safety & Security and the Jefferson County Sheriff's Office conducted a thorough search of the building yesterday, finding no suspicious items, and we are starting the second search today.

We are continuing to partner with local law enforcement to investigate the situation and determine where the threat and information came from and whether or not these are swatting incidents. The Department of School Safety, along with our School Resource Officer, Deputy Jenkinson, are working together to support our school. There will be additional members of their team here today, as already planned, as a precaution to ensure the safety of our students and staff.

Once the building is cleared, we are going to run school as we normally would. We want to reassure you that it is safe for your student to be at school. We are asking staff and students to wait outside on the athletic field until the sweep is completed.

It is important that we continue to take threats seriously. Please take some time to remind your student that any potential safety concerns should be reported to you and to the school, no matter how insignificant they believe it might be. Students may also call the Safe2Tell program to report safety concerns anonymously at 877-542-7233, online at https://safe2tell.org/, or the app (iOS | Android).

What we do know is that all of these situations, whether real or false, are distressing and strip away the sense of security in our schools and communities. We also understand and support a family's right to decide to keep their students home today and will excuse their absence.

Thank you for continuing to partner with us. If you have any questions, please feel free to contact our main office at 303-982-3056.
